# The order of packages is significant, because pip processes them in the order
# of appearance. Changing the order has an impact on the overall integration
# process, which may cause wedges in the gate later.
pbr>=2.0.0 # Apache-2.0
eventlet!=0.18.3,>=0.18.2 # MIT
netaddr!=0.7.16,>=0.7.13 # BSD
SQLAlchemy>=1.0.10 # MIT
alembic>=0.8.10 # MIT
six>=1.9.0 # MIT
neutron-lib>=1.3.0 # Apache-2.0
oslo.config>=3.22.0 # Apache-2.0
oslo.db>=4.19.0 # Apache-2.0
oslo.log>=3.22.0 # Apache-2.0
oslo.messaging>=5.19.0 # Apache-2.0
oslo.serialization>=1.10.0 # Apache-2.0
oslo.service>=1.10.0 # Apache-2.0
oslo.utils>=3.20.0 # Apache-2.0
oslo.privsep>=1.9.0 # Apache-2.0
pyroute2>=0.4.12 # Apache-2.0 (+ dual licensed GPL2)
# This project does depend on neutron as a library, but the
# openstack tooling does not play nicely with projects that
# are not publicly available in pypi.
# -e git+https://git.openstack.org/openstack/neutron#egg=neutron
